Tasting from 11.10.2023: Ulrich Sautter

A very intense cassis nose, also black currant confit, elderberry. The mouth shows a cultured, fine-grained tannin, lots of dark berry fruit and extracted sweetness that pleasantly supports the juicy elegance. Very good aromatic length.
